The Blackpool FC Club Shop is to close for refurbishment once the game against Oxford United gets underway tomorrow.
The retail space will remain closed until Friday 30 August, when a brand new layout and range of merchandise will be unveiled.
The ticket office side of the retail space is unaffected by the closure and will be open as normal during this period.
 
From 9am tomorrow (Tuesday), supporters will be able to purchase match tickets from our new unit in the Houndshill Shopping Centre.
The unit, which has been utilised by Blackpool FC Community Trust, will be selling tickets for Saturday's home fixture against Portsmouth, as well a few bits of merchandise.
To mark the opening, a few first-team players will also be in store from 4pm for a signing session.

You'll find us next to Timpsons, near the Victoria Street entrance, with the unit to be open throughout the week from 9am until 5.30pm.

Blackpool Football Club is pleased to announce a partnership with Lookers Volkswagen for the 2019-20 season.
The arrangement sees Lookers Volkswagen Blackpool become the club’s Official Vehicle Partner, supplying seven cars and a kit van for operational use.
The dealership, based on Ashworth Road in Blackpool, will also sponsor the vomitories at Bloomfield Road and provide sponsored racing car seats in the front rows of the home and away dugouts at the stadium.

Ben Hatton, Blackpool FC’s Managing Director, said:
“We are delighted to partner with the local branch of a global brand in Lookers Volkswagen Blackpool. This deal provides numerous benefits from an operational point of view and helps us continue driving forward at what is an exciting time for the club.”
Paul Meadowcroft, Brand Manager at Lookers Volkswagen Blackpool, added:
“We at Lookers Blackpool are really excited to have agreed a vehicle supply deal with Blackpool FC in what is a new and exciting period for the club. We look forward to a long and mutual motoring relationship with all the club employees and fans.”
